Trader’s Checklist for Today

General risk management reminder: Avoid placing trades immediately before or after high-impact releases unless you have a tested strategy. Slippage and false breakouts are common. ✅ Spread widening expected: During the ISM Services PMI and FOMC minutes release, spreads on USD pairs and gold may widen significantly. Consider using limit orders or reducing position size. ✅ Review position sizing: Before the FOMC minutes, ensure your account has sufficient margin to withstand potential volatility spikes, especially if holding positions overnight.
